Transaction d96027228d78b8723466390fb7f1c692f6be7a183137fb0912c1cc60d199a045
1 Input
2 Outputs
- d96027228d78b8723466390fb7f1c692f6be7a183137fb0912c1cc60d199a045:0
- d96027228d78b8723466390fb7f1c692f6be7a183137fb0912c1cc60d199a045:1
value 105486
address 3QHupJUyj9XKz9CCMaKTSH6vaFiXRaU6MY
value 42274
address 19jJQUDC8ZRt5GGm6ep483PjSHnoPSfPuJ